Meineke Franchisee Apologizes for Politics in Ad
A Meineke franchisee put a political message into an ad after the chain's marketing vice president had approved it without the political statement.
An ad on Page A3 on Feb. 3 for deals at two South Mississippi Meineke locations contained the phrase “AMERICA RISING: We are taking our country back 11/02/10,” which refers to the date of congressional elections. America Rising is the title of a video circulating among conservative political Web sites that warns President Barack Obama and the Democratic majority in Congress that conservatives intend to take back Congress in the fall.
The franchisee publicly apologized.
“Please accept my humble apology for including inappropriate language in the Meineke Complete Car Care ad that appeared in this paper on Feb. 3,” Harris wrote in the apology. “I accept full responsibility for this indiscretion since the language in the ad violated Meineke’s internal advertising policy. - Sun Herald
